Ralph Sampson, Jr., Sun Pon, was born in The Dalles, Oregon and lived at Celilo until it was flooded by the creation of Dalles Dam in 1957. He was raised in Harrah, graduated from White Swan High School, and continued his education at the University of Washington and Oregon State University.

Sampson worked for the Bureau of Indian Affairs (BIA) for nearly 30 years before retiring. Stationed at the Glenwood Ranger Station he served as a Wildland Fire Fighter, journeyman Log Scaler, and Timber Sales Officer. His career provided extensive experience in natural resource management, public service, and stewardship of Tribal lands.

Sampson was first elected to Yakama Nation Tribal Council in 2005 and served until 2009. He was re-elected in 2023 and is the Chairman of the Health, Employment, Welfare Recreation, Youth Activities Committee (Chairman); Law & Order Committee (Chairman); and Veteran’s Committee (Chairman). He also serves on the Loan, Extension, Education and Housing Committee (Member).
